The term "thermal overload protector" refers specifically to a device that disconnects power to the motor when it overheats. This is a critical safety feature in motors, designed to prevent damage that can occur due to excessive heat, which may be caused by overloading or an operational fault.

When the motor operates beyond its rated capacity, its temperature rises. The thermal overload protector detects this increase in temperature and interrupts the power supply to prevent overheating, which can lead to insulation failure or even catastrophic failure of the motor. This protective mechanism ensures the longevity and reliable operation of the motor by safeguarding it against potential thermal damage.
